Fined for not following lockdown in Faridganj. In Faridganj, on the 4th day of the lockdown, a mobile court imposed a fine for not using mask and for keeping shop open.

Assistant Commissioner (Land) and Executive Magistrate Sharmin Akhter and Police Station Officer-in-Charge Mohammad Shahid Hossain conducted the mobile court on Saturday, April 17 for not wearing masks and keeping the shops open in Gazipur Bazar and Purba Chandra Bazar of the upazila.

A fine of Tk. 6,500 was levied in three cases under Section 269 of the Penal Code for not using mask and keeping the shop open.

In this regard, Assistant Commissioner (Land) Sharmin Akhter and Police Station Officer-in-Charge Mohammad Shahid Hossain said, “We have carried out this operation in Gazipur Bazar and East Chandra Bazar of the upazila for not using masks and keeping the shops open as per the instructions of the government.”

Traders have kept almost all the shops open in Faridganj Sadar Bazar.
